How Much Does a Construction Manager Make in Los Angeles, CA?

The median Construction Manager salary in Los Angeles, CA is $127,600 per year as of 2025, according to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. This is 11% higher than the national median of $114,990.

Salaries in Los Angeles range from $73,600 at the 10th percentile to $211,600 at the 90th percentile. The middle 50% of Construction Managers in Los Angeles earn between $95,600 and $168,800 per year.

Source: U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S), May 2025. Occupation: Construction Manager (SOC 11-9021).
